The module works with all 8, 12, and 16-bit A/D modules and boards, and has factory-set differential instrumentation gains ranging from 1 3 to 10,000 3 . It also has a true (not software compensated) minimal offset of 1.5 Vm or better and has accurate unity gain and a ±10-V input and output range. Filter characteristics (Butterworth, Bessel, Cauer, or Linear Phase) are selectable to any corner frequency within the maximum filter bandwidth. Filters can be tuned to a variety of bandwidths from 0 to 200 kHz, and output impedance is <0.001 ohms. Common mode rejection is 90 to 110 dB. Input and output range is up to 10 V while gain accuracy is 0.001 dB at 1 skHz.
